Fog wreaks havoc again, 29 flights diverted to Fujairah

- Amira Agarib amira@khaleejtim­es.com

fujairah — Bad weather and fog disrupted the flight services in the country for a second consecutiv­e day.

The Fujairah Police said via Instagram on Thursday that 29 flights were diverted to Fujairah Internatio­nal Airport from other airports in the country, and the facilities and services at the airport are equipped to meet the needs of travellers on those flights.

The Commander-in-chief of Fujairah Police Brigadier Mohammed Ahmed bin Ghanim Al Kaabi, said all department­s cooperated including the civil aviation authority, immigratio­n and passports controller­s, management of ports, airports, police, and the Fujairah transporta­tion foundation have contribute­d in facilitati­ng the procedures for the passengers. Meanwhile, an Emirates spokespers­on said: “Severe fog in Dubai on (Thursday) has caused numerous delays to Emirates flights arriving and departing at Dubai Internatio­nal Airport. 107 accidents in Dubai

As many as 107 accidents took place in Dubai from 4am to 10am. The accidents occurred in various areas in Dubai; no injuries were reported. The command and control room of the Dubai Police has received a total of 1,164 calls until 12pm.
